Soumalya's work from the group is out on ChemRxiv. This work reports the first stable square antiprismatic Pd8L16 architecture, as a new member of the PdnL2n metal-organic cage family. The ideal coordination vector angle for a square antiprism of ~105 degrees is achieved through use of perfluorinated ligands, which drive dihedral twisting to diverge the coordination vectors.
